|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Family Support Specialist | Provide guidance and resources to families on health and safety concerns. |
| Health Educator | Educate families on health promotion and disease prevention strategies. |
| Community Health Worker | Connect families with community resources and support services. |
| Family Advocate | Advocate for families' needs and rights in healthcare settings. |
| Parent Educator | Provide parenting education and support to families. |
